
Katherine Priddy is Matthew’s guest on this month’s show, telling the personal stories behind the songs on her beautiful new album “These Frightening Machines”. There’s also music from Mumford and Sons, Hen Ogledd, Catrin Finch, Lucy Kitchen, Hedera and Georgia Shackleton. Lucy Shields previews forthcoming album releases and gigs and Matthew reveals the next episode of Folk on Foot.---We rely on support from our listeners to keep this show on the road.
